Ring Video Doorbell 2 not working with TP-Link Deco M9 plus

Hi,

I have problems connecting my Ring Video Doorbell 2 to the WiFi network of my TP-Link Deco M9 plus. I have read several seemingly related posts. These are marked as solved while the given solution doesn’t work for my configuration.

My configuration:

Ring Video Doorbell 2 with updated firmware

TP-Link Deco M9 plus with updated firmware

I have tried connecting with and without fast roaming activated. I have tried connecting to the WiFi as well as to a WiFi Guest network 2.4 only. The results are unpredictable in the sense that no working connection is made but that the Ring shows either the top two lights or the right two lights blinking white.

From what I can tell Ring Doorbells have issues with Mesh networks. I have a replacement on the way but I don’t think it will solve the problem. I have set my Deco M5 network to send notifications when my Ring Doorbell connects and disconnects. On average it connects and disconnects every 2-3 minutes. Sometime multiples times with in a minute. I have tried a guest network set to only 2.4Ghz with beamforming on/off and fast roaming on/off and Mesh on/off on the device only.

I have since created a new wifi network with an old TP Link router and the connection seems to be stable. My conclusion is Ring + TP Link Mesh = FAIL
